Katherine Burton was born in Geneva, Switzerland, on September 10, 1957, is an American actress. Young Kate Burton first started performing in school theater productions. She made her big screen debut in drama film Anne of the Thousand Days (1969) in uncredited role as Serving Maid. She got her television debut in anthology series Great Performances (1983) in role as Alice. Kate breakthrough performance came as Fran Richardson in Fox sitcom Monty (1994) at Alvin Theatre. She landed her Broadway debut in a play "Present Laughter" (1982) in role as Daphne Stillington, at Circle in the Square Theatre.

She won the Daytime Emmy Award for Outstanding Performer in a Children's Special for her role as Brenda Gardner in anthology series ABC Afterschool Special (1995) in episode "Notes for My Daughter".
She was nominated for three Primetime Emmy Awards for Outstanding Guest Actress in a Drama Series and won the Gold Derby TV Award for Drama Guest Actress for her role as Ellis Grey in medical drama television series Grey's Anatomy (2005-2023).
She was nominated for the Primetime Emmy Award for Outstanding Guest Actress in a Drama Series for her role as Vice President Sally Langston in ABC political thriller television series Scandal (2012-2018).

Graduated from Brown University in 1979.
Graduated from Yale School of Drama in 1982.
She is daughter of actor Richard Burton.
She was nominated for the Tony Award for Best Performance by an Actress in a Featured Role in a Play for her role as Pinhead, Mrs. Kendal in a play "The Elephant Man" (2002) at Royale Theatre.
She was nominated for the Tony Award for Best Performance by an Actress in a Leading Role in a Play for her role as Hedda Tesman in a play "Hedda Gabler" (2001-2002) at Ambassador Theatre.
She was nominated for the Tony Award for Best Performance by an Actress in a Leading Role in a Play for her role as Constance Middleton in a play "The Constant Wife" (2005) at American Airlines Theatre.
Good friend with actress Jane Kaczmarek.
She married theatre director Michael Ritchie in 1984, they have a son, Morgan Ivor and a daughter, Charlotte Frances.
